Beschreibung:

Binding.- Heylyn (John) Theological Lectures at Westminster-Abbey. With an Interpretation of the New Testament, 2 vol. in 1, occasional spotting and marginal water-staining, ink name 'Elizabeth Cottrell Dormer' to title, contemporary red morocco, richly gilt, covers with wide borders combining crown, floral and foliage tools, spine in compartments and richly gilt with various floral and foliage tools, along with a black morocco label, upper joint stareting at foot, but holding firm, corners worn, rubbed and marked, g.e., 4to, Printed for J. and R. Tonson and S. Draper in the Strand, 1749.
